Guidelines for Optimizing Drying and Blow-Off Operations

Jon Barber,, Director, Spraying Systems Co

You probably don't spend much time thinking about all the applications in your plant that require compressed air. But compressed air is a costly utility that can easily account for 1/3 of a plant's total electricity usage.

Yet, compressed air is often viewed as a fixed cost and overlooked when process improvements are considered. If that's the case in your plant, it may be time to revisit that approach because you may be able to save tens of thousands or even hundreds of thousands of dollars annually by significantly reducing compressed air consumption or by using a different technology for some drying and blow-off operations. . .
